In a non-traumatic setting, flexion and extension views may be performed. The expected distance between the anterior arch of C1 and the dens in the fully flexed position should be <3 mm in an adult (~5 mm in a child) 5. See more WebIn 2004, Gonzalez et al. measured the C1 and C2 lateral mass interval or atlantoaxial interval in 93 adult control patients who underwent CT angiography. They found that in 95% of healthy adults, the atlantoaxial interval ranged between 0.7 and 2.6 mm, and they considered an atlantoaxial interval of greater than 2.6 mm to indicate the ...
